AmaWaterways Unveils Two New River Ships for 2026

AmaWaterways has announced the launch of two new river ships set to debut in 2026. These new additions, AmaMaya and AmaSofia, are designed to meet the growing demand for unique travel experiences along some of the world's most picturesque rivers.

 

Launching on May 24, 2026, AmaSofia will become the 24th vessel in AmaWaterways' European fleet. AmaSofia will offer 31 departures in 2026, featuring other popular itineraries on the Danube like "Melodies of the Danube," "Romantic Danube," and the festive "Christmas Markets on the Danube."

 

Its maiden voyage, titled "Magnificent Europe," is a 14-night journey that will take passengers from Amsterdam to Budapest, traversing three iconic rivers through four different countries. This itinerary is packed with culturally rich experiences such as guided bike rides through scenic vineyards, visits to local bakeries, and tours of historic castles and palaces.

 

AmaMaya is set to embark on its inaugural voyage on August 3, 2026. This seven-night cruise will explore the cultural and historical treasures of Vietnam and Cambodia. Guests will indulge in regional delicacies, participate in daily excursions, and enjoy luxurious amenities aboard the ship. AmaMaya will conduct 22 sailings in 2026, with plans to increase to 38 sailings in 2027.

 

The cruise line offers unlimited wine, beer, and soft drinks with meals, as well as a daily Sip & Sail cocktail hour. A variety of small group excursions are available, ranging from hiking and biking to special interest tours. Additionally, the ships provide high-quality Wi-Fi, a comprehensive Wellness Program with fitness classes, and convenient airport transfers.

 

AmaWaterways continues to lead the way in river cruising, offering exceptional service and unique itineraries. The introduction of AmaSofia and AmaMaya will further enhance their reputation, providing travelers with unforgettable journeys filled with cultural enrichment and luxury.
